-- High Precision BGA Stencil For BGA Assembly
1. Stencil Type: lasercut (mostly made from stainless steel) or electroformed stencils (Nickel)
should be preferred.
2. Stencil aperture and the stencil thickness determine BGA soldering paste volume.
3. High prececision BGA stencil thickness has to be matched to the needs of all BGA package
parts on the PCB.
For instance, Infinion brand BGA is recommended to use 100 - 150 µm thick stencils.
4. Stencil apertures should be circular shape. The aperture diameter should be the same as
the metal pad diameter on the PCB or slightly above.

-- BGA Soldering For BGA Assembly
1. BGA Soldering determines the highest quality of BGA assembly.
2. Optimizing the thermal profile as a preliminary yet critical step in the BGA assembly process
that analyze in a detail manner your PCB files, BGA package parts data sheets, BGA size and
ball material composition (leaded or lead-free); For large BGA sizes, the thermal profile is
optimized by localizing internal BGA heating to prevent a void.
